MOGADISHU — More than 143,500 people have been displaced across Somalia since January 2022 due to forced evictions, wiping out over $4.6 million in critical infrastructure, according to a new report by the Norwegian Refugee Council (NRC). The vast majority of these evictions — 82% — have occurred in Mogadishu, …
